Leading online travel agent ebookers.com today announced the UK launch of “ebookers for agents” – its affiliate programme that offers travel agents full access to ebookers’ hotel, package, flight and car products and affords travel agents the opportunity to earn high commissions from the re-sale of these products to consumers.

Following the UK launch, “ebookers for agents” will be rolled out across ebookers’ other European websites during the remainder of 2010. Travel agents can easily sign up for the programme on ebookers.com website (www.ebookersforagents.com) and on a dedicated telephone line.

Gilles Despas, ebookers’ B2B Vice President, said of the programme, “ebookers for agents will enable travel agent customers to benefit from the hotel and package deals negotiated by our Global sourcing team, whilst still allowing travel agents the freedom to manage important revenue streams such as service charges and mark-ups’’.

Steven Rice, Head of Offline Marketing for UK, France and Ireland, added, “ebookers for agents is the perfect solution for travel agents who want access to an enhanced range of hotel and package deals whilst earning extremely competitive commissions. There is no cost for agents to sign up to the programme. They receive free access to over 90,000 hotels, thousands of customised packages, flights from hundreds of airlines, and car rental hire from over 7,000 pick-up points”.

Standard commission rates include 10% for standalone hotel and 4% for package bookings. The first 100 travel agents to sign up and book on the site by June 30th 2010 will earn higher commissions on sales of hotel and vacation packages for a one year period on all bookings.

The launch of the ebookers programme follows the launch of a similar programme from Orbitz.com, ebookers’ parent company and one of the largest online travel agents in the World. “Orbitz for agents” was launched in February in the USA and offers travel agents the opportunity to receive commissions for hotel and customised vacation package bookings made for their customers on the Orbitz for Agents (OFA) website.
